- Preheat oven to 400 degrees. 
- In a small bowl, whisk together first 5 ingredients (garlic through black pepper); rub mixture into both sides of tenderloin until well coated. 
- Melt the coconut oil in a large ovenproof skillet over medium-high heat until hot. Add pork tenderloin; sear for 2 minutes per side then transfer skillet to the preheated oven. 
- Roast for 18 to 20 minutes or until tenderloin is cooked through.
